Product details
Overview
AD7908BRU from Analog Devices is an 8-bit, 1 MSPS, 8-channel successive approximation ADC with integrated channel sequencer, operating from a single 2.7 V to 5.25 V supply and delivering 6 mW max power dissipation at 3 V. It features SPI/QSPI/MICROWIRE/DSP-compatible serial interface, no pipeline delay, and 20-lead TSSOP packaging for space-constrained industrial data acquisition systems.
For engineers reviewing the AD7908BRU datasheet, AD7908BRU pinout, AD7908BRU application, or AD7908BRU equivalent, key selection criteria include its 8-bit resolution with ±0.2 LSB INL/DNL, 49 dB SINAD at 50 kHz, 0 V to REFIN or 0 V to 2 × REFIN input range configurability, VDRIVE logic-level independence, and automotive-qualified temperature range (−40°C to +125°C).
Technical Context
The AD7908BRU implements a standard SAR architecture with track-and-hold amplifier supporting >8 MHz input bandwidth and precise sampling controlled by CS falling edge. Conversion timing is fully synchronous to SCLK, requiring exactly 16 clock cycles (e.g., 800 ns at 20 MHz), with no latency between sample initiation and result availability.
Its control register enables flexible configuration: RANGE bit selects 0 V to REFIN (straight binary) or 0 V to 2 × REFIN (twos complement); CODING bit sets output format; SEQ and SHADOW bits program channel sequencing order across VIN0–VIN7 inputs. VDRIVE decouples logic interface voltage (2.7 V–5.25 V) from AVDD, enabling direct interfacing with 3 V or 5 V microcontrollers without level shifters.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| Resolution | 8-bit - delivers 256 discrete output codes for moderate-precision sensor monitoring and control feedback loops. |
| Throughput Rate | 1 MSPS - supports real-time sampling of fast transients in motor control or power quality monitoring. |
| SINAD @ 50 kHz | 49 dB min - ensures usable dynamic range for 8-bit conversion of audio-band or vibration signals. |
| INL / DNL | ±0.2 LSB max - guarantees monotonicity and no missing codes, critical for closed-loop stability. |
| Power Dissipation | 6 mW max at 3 V - enables battery-powered or thermally constrained embedded systems without active cooling. |
| Input Range Options | 0 V to REFIN (2.5 V) or 0 V to 2 × REFIN - configurable via RANGE bit for unipolar or pseudo-bipolar signal conditioning. |
| Shutdown Current | 0.5 μA max - allows ultra-low-power sleep modes in portable instrumentation during idle periods. |
Pinout & Package
AD7908BRU is housed in a 20-lead Thin Shrink Small Outline Package (TSSOP) with exposed pad for thermal enhancement and standard JEDEC MS-013AC footprint. Pin functions are validated per Analog Devices Rev. E datasheet Figure 3 and Table 6.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| SCLK (Pin 1) | Serial Clock Input | Master clock for both data transfer and internal conversion timing; falling edge clocks DIN, rising edge samples DOUT. |
| DIN (Pin 2) | Control Register Data Input | Accepts 16-bit command word (address + config bits) on falling SCLK edges to set RANGE, CODING, SEQ, SHADOW. |
| CS (Pin 3) | Chip Select / Conversion Trigger | Active-low signal that initiates sampling on falling edge and frames serial communication window. |
| AGND (Pins 4, 8, 17, 20) | Analog Ground Reference | Common return for all analog circuitry; must be star-connected to minimize noise coupling into VIN/REFIN paths. |
| AVDD (Pins 5, 6) | Analog Power Supply | Single 2.7 V–5.25 V rail powering core ADC, T/H, and reference buffer; requires local 10 μF + 100 nF decoupling. |
| REFIN (Pin 7) | External Reference Input | Accepts 2.5 V ±1% precision reference; impedance ~36 kΩ at 1 MSPS; drives internal scaling network for input range selection. |
| VIN0–VIN7 (Pins 9–16) | Single-Ended Analog Inputs | Eight multiplexed channels with 20 pF input capacitance; unused pins must tie to AGND to prevent noise pickup. |
| DOUT (Pin 18) | Serial Data Output | MSB-first stream: 1 leading zero + 3 address bits + 8 data bits + 4 trailing zeros; tri-state controlled by CS. |
| VDRIVE (Pin 19) | Digital Interface Supply | Defines logic thresholds (0.3×/0.7×VDRIVE) independently of AVDD-enables mixed-voltage system interfacing. |
Key Features
| Feature | Design Value |
|---|---|
| No pipeline delay | Sampled value appears in DOUT within 16 SCLK cycles-enables deterministic timing for time-critical control loops. |
| VDRIVE logic-level independence | Serial interface operates at 3 V or 5 V regardless of AVDD, eliminating external level shifters in heterogeneous voltage systems. |
| Programmable channel sequencer | Configurable sequence of up to 8 VIN channels via control register-reduces host processor overhead in multi-sensor polling. |
| Flexible input range selection | 0 V to REFIN (unipolar) or 0 V to 2 × REFIN (pseudo-bipolar) selected by RANGE bit-supports diverse sensor output types without external op-amp gain stages. |
| Automotive qualification | Specified over −40°C to +125°C ambient and qualified to AEC-Q100-suitable for engine control, battery management, and ADAS subsystems. |

FAQ
What is the maximum sampling rate supported by the AD7908BRU?
The AD7908BRU supports a maximum throughput rate of 1 MSPS, achieved with a 20 MHz SCLK frequency and 16-cycle conversion time (800 ns). This rate is maintained across the full −40°C to +125°C automotive temperature range and is independent of input channel selection due to its internal sequencer architecture.
Does the AD7908BRU require an external reference voltage?
Yes, the AD7908BRU requires an external 2.5 V ±1% reference applied to the REFIN pin. The device does not include an internal reference; REFIN directly sets the full-scale input range (0 V to REFIN or 0 V to 2 × REFIN) and impacts gain accuracy, with typical REFIN input impedance of 36 kΩ at 1 MSPS.
How does the VDRIVE pin function in the AD7908BRU?
The VDRIVE pin on the AD7908BRU sets the logic threshold levels (0.3×VDRIVE and 0.7×VDRIVE) for all digital interface pins (SCLK, DIN, CS, DOUT), decoupling them from AVDD. This allows direct connection to 3 V or 5 V microcontrollers even when AVDD is at a different voltage, eliminating external level shifters in mixed-voltage designs.
Can the AD7908BRU perform automatic sequential conversion across all eight channels?
Yes, the AD7908BRU includes a programmable channel sequencer controlled via the SEQ and SHADOW bits in its 16-bit control register. Once configured, it automatically cycles through a user-defined subset of VIN0–VIN7 channels in sequence, outputting results with embedded 3-bit channel address bits in each DOUT frame-reducing host software overhead.
What are the absolute maximum ratings for AVDD and REFIN on the AD7908BRU?
The AD7908BRU has an absolute maximum AVDD rating of −0.3 V to +7 V relative to AGND, and REFIN must remain between −0.3 V and AVDD + 0.3 V. Exceeding these limits-even momentarily-may cause permanent damage. For reliable operation, AVDD must be maintained within 2.7 V to 5.25 V, and REFIN must be 2.5 V ±1%.
